The Secret to Healthy Bedding in Your Coop

When we first started our backyard chicken journey, we did a lot of research on bedding for our girls. Clean, dry bedding is paramount in keeping your chickens healthy. Yet, if you have kept chickens for any length of time, you know they poop a lot wherever and whenever they want.

Chicken poop contains nitrogen and when it’s broken down by bacteria or by getting wet, it creates ammonia. Too much of this can cause respiratory stress or other infections in your chickens. So, the need for good ventilation is vital to your chickens health as well as dry bedding.

We use the deep litter method around here. It works great with our set up and creates amazing compost for our gardens as well. We use pine shavings in our litter. Some use straw or other materials. Any of these options are fine, but please make sure you do NOT use cedar shavings. As much as we all love that smell, cedar shavings contain oils that can harm your chicken’s respiratory system.
